82-Year-Old Woman Loses Life in Whitby Accident

Durham police report that an 82-year-old woman has died after being hit by a vehicle while trying to cross a street in Whitby on Friday.

In a social media update on Saturday, the Durham Regional Police Service mentioned that officers were called to the scene of the collision at Brock Street N. and Mary Street W. around 1:15 p. m.

The pedestrian was taken to a hospital in the Toronto area with life-threatening injuries, where she later passed away.

The driver stayed at the scene and cooperated with law enforcement during their investigation, according to Durham police.

In a post on social media Friday, Durham police informed that the intersection of Brock Road N. and Mary Street W. had been closed for the investigation. The roadways reopened around 7 p. m. Friday, as stated by Durham police to CBC Toronto.

If anyone has information, they are encouraged to reach out to the police.
